We live in a wooded area in the country and are often invaded by the roaches from the surrounding woods. We have tried all types of sprays, had exterminators out and the best thing that we have found to get rid of them is plain old boric acid powder. Sprinkle it around the cabinet tops and along the floor in front of the cabinets. It will get rid of them. If the eggs hatch out and you see baby roaches, repeat the process. This could take several dustings to totally eliminate the infestation.
Also, don't leave food, dog and cat food, etc. setting out. It attracts the roaches.
